I've got 515 marks in neet 2020 and from general category , can i get a seat in afmc?

It's quite difficult to predict that whether you will get  seat or not as  cut off marks for medical colleges keeps changing every year  depending upon various factors like  number of students that appeared in the exam, kind of marks obtained by them , toughness level of the examination etc.


But when we go through previous data then it suggests that with 515 marks you may not get a seat in A FMC

For example,

In 2019 , 596 marks was required  for boys and 610 marks in neet was required for girls to get into AFMC

In 2019 under All India Quota, a score of 595 marks was the cut off for boys and 610 was the cut off for girls. Going by that, 515 might be a tad less score. Having said that, this is based on 2019 data and cut offs change every year. Cut offs change every year depending on various factors such as no.of Candidates appearing for the exam, no.of Candidates qualified, top NEET score and difficulty of the exam.
